Abstract
BACKGROUND: Disease knowledge, appropriate attitude, and proper practices play an important role in disease control and reduction of diabetes-related complications and deaths. This study aims to investigate the impact of knowledge, attitude, and practices (KAPs) of Type 2 diabetic patients' outcomes.Entities:
